Subject: pkg/17661: Wine update to 20020710
To: None <gnats-bugs@gnats.netbsd.org>
From: Tomasz Luchowski <zuntum@netbsd.org>
List: netbsd-bugs
Date: 07/20/2002 14:31:46
>Number: 17661
>Category: pkg
>Synopsis: Wine update to 20020710
>Confidential: no
>Severity: non-critical
>Priority: medium
>Responsible: pkg-manager
>State: open
>Class: change-request
>Submitter-Id: net
>Arrival-Date: Sat Jul 20 05:32:00 PDT 2002
>Closed-Date:
>Last-Modified:
>Originator:
>Release: NetBSD 1.6_BETA4
>Organization:
>Environment:
System: NetBSD zunpc 1.6_BETA4 NetBSD 1.6_BETA4 (ZUNPC) #1: Sat Jul 6 01:47:43 CEST 2002 zuntum@zunpc:/usr/cvs/src/sys/arch/i386/compile/ZUNPC i386
Architecture: i386
Machine: i386
>Description:
emulators/wine version 20020411 refused to run my polish-english dictionary executable
properly. I have updated the wine package to 20020710 version and the problem disappeared.
XXX: I am not sure whether patches/patch-ab attached here is entirely correct.
I was getting some "NGROUP undeclared" errors, and the patch seems to fix those.
I also get the following message when I run wine:
>Wine cannot find the FreeType font library. To enable Wine to
>use TrueType fonts please install a version of FreeType greater than
>or equal to 2.0.5.
>http://www.freetype.org
I think I *do* have freetype (it is included in XFree86 4.x, is it not),
and the proper buildlink.mk *is* mentioned at the beginning of the build proccess.
No idea.
If you think the update is okay, please commit it yourself. Yep, I know we're in the freeze,
but it makes significant improvement at least for me.
? patches/patch-ab
Index: Makefile
===================================================================
RCS file: /cvsroot/pkgsrc/emulators/wine/Makefile,v
retrieving revision 1.27
diff -u -r1.27 Makefile
--- Makefile 2002/04/20 08:20:16 1.27
+++ Makefile 2002/07/20 12:24:16
@@ -1,6 +1,6 @@
# $NetBSD: Makefile,v 1.27 2002/04/20 08:20:16 rh Exp $
-DISTNAME= Wine-20020411
+DISTNAME= Wine-20020710
PKGNAME= ${DISTNAME:S/W/w/}
WRKSRC= ${WRKDIR}/${PKGNAME}
CATEGORIES= emulators
Index: PLIST
===================================================================
RCS file: /cvsroot/pkgsrc/emulators/wine/PLIST,v
retrieving revision 1.3
diff -u -r1.3 PLIST
--- PLIST 2002/04/20 08:20:16 1.3
+++ PLIST 2002/07/20 12:24:16
@@ -1,22 +1,27 @@
-@comment $NetBSD: PLIST,v 1.3 2002/04/20 08:20:16 rh Exp $
-bin/fnt2bdf
+@comment $NetBSD$
bin/function_grep.pl
+bin/notepad
+bin/progman
+bin/regedit
+bin/regsvr32
+bin/uninstaller
+bin/wcmd
bin/wine
bin/winebuild
bin/wineclipsrv
bin/wineconsole
-bin/wineconsole.so
bin/winedbg
-bin/winedbg.so
bin/winedump
+bin/winefile
bin/winelauncher
bin/winemaker
+bin/winemine
+bin/winepath
bin/wineserver
bin/wineshelllink
+bin/winhelp
bin/wmc
bin/wrc
-include/wine/amaudio.h
-include/wine/amvideo.h
include/wine/audevcod.h
include/wine/basetsd.h
include/wine/cderr.h
@@ -25,7 +30,6 @@
include/wine/commctrl.h
include/wine/commdlg.h
include/wine/compobj.h
-include/wine/control.h
include/wine/cpl.h
include/wine/d3d.h
include/wine/d3dcaps.h
@@ -46,9 +50,6 @@
include/wine/dplobby.h
include/wine/dshow.h
include/wine/dsound.h
-include/wine/dvdmedia.h
-include/wine/errors.h
-include/wine/evcode.h
include/wine/guiddef.h
include/wine/imagehlp.h
include/wine/imm.h
@@ -97,6 +98,7 @@
include/wine/msvcrt/time.h
include/wine/msvcrt/wchar.h
include/wine/msvcrt/wctype.h
+include/wine/mswsock.h
include/wine/nb30.h
include/wine/nspapi.h
include/wine/ntsecapi.h
@@ -136,7 +138,6 @@
include/wine/sqlext.h
include/wine/sqltypes.h
include/wine/storage.h
-include/wine/strmif.h
include/wine/tapi.h
include/wine/tlhelp32.h
include/wine/unknwn.h
@@ -160,6 +161,7 @@
include/wine/wine/obj_cache.h
include/wine/wine/obj_channel.h
include/wine/wine/obj_clientserver.h
+include/wine/wine/obj_comcat.h
include/wine/wine/obj_commdlgbrowser.h
include/wine/wine/obj_connection.h
include/wine/wine/obj_contextmenu.h
@@ -167,11 +169,11 @@
include/wine/wine/obj_dataobject.h
include/wine/wine/obj_dockingwindowframe.h
include/wine/wine/obj_dragdrop.h
+include/wine/wine/obj_enumguid.h
include/wine/wine/obj_enumidlist.h
include/wine/wine/obj_errorinfo.h
include/wine/wine/obj_extracticon.h
include/wine/wine/obj_inplace.h
-include/wine/wine/obj_ksproperty.h
include/wine/wine/obj_marshal.h
include/wine/wine/obj_misc.h
include/wine/wine/obj_moniker.h
@@ -228,32 +230,40 @@
lib/libwine_unicode.so
lib/libwine_unicode.so.1.0
lib/libwine_uuid.a
-lib/libwinspool.drv.so
-lib/libx11drv.dll.so
lib/wine/advapi32.dll.so
lib/wine/avicap32.dll.so
lib/wine/avifil32.dll.so
lib/wine/avifile.dll.so
+lib/wine/aviinfo.exe.so
+lib/wine/aviplay.exe.so
+lib/wine/clock.exe.so
+lib/wine/cmdlgtst.exe.so
+lib/wine/comcat.dll.so
lib/wine/comctl32.dll.so
lib/wine/comdlg32.dll.so
lib/wine/comm.dll.so
lib/wine/commdlg.dll.so
lib/wine/compobj.dll.so
+lib/wine/control.exe.so
lib/wine/crtdll.dll.so
lib/wine/crypt32.dll.so
+lib/wine/d3d8.dll.so
lib/wine/dciman32.dll.so
lib/wine/ddeml.dll.so
lib/wine/ddraw.dll.so
lib/wine/devenum.dll.so
lib/wine/dinput.dll.so
+lib/wine/dinput8.dll.so
lib/wine/dispdib.dll.so
lib/wine/display.dll.so
lib/wine/dplay.dll.so
lib/wine/dplayx.dll.so
lib/wine/dsound.dll.so
+lib/wine/expand.exe.so
lib/wine/gdi.exe.so
lib/wine/gdi32.dll.so
lib/wine/glu32.dll.so
+lib/wine/icinfo.exe.so
lib/wine/icmp.dll.so
lib/wine/imaadp32.acm.so
lib/wine/imagehlp.dll.so
@@ -278,8 +288,9 @@
lib/wine/msacm.dll.so
lib/wine/msacm.drv.so
lib/wine/msacm32.dll.so
+lib/wine/msadp32.acm.so
lib/wine/msdmo.dll.so
-lib/wine/msg711.drv.so
+lib/wine/msg711.acm.so
lib/wine/msimg32.dll.so
lib/wine/msisys.ocx.so
lib/wine/msnet32.dll.so
@@ -289,6 +300,7 @@
lib/wine/msvfw32.dll.so
lib/wine/msvideo.dll.so
lib/wine/netapi32.dll.so
+lib/wine/notepad.exe.so
lib/wine/ntdll.dll.so
lib/wine/odbc32.dll.so
lib/wine/ole2.dll.so
@@ -306,11 +318,17 @@
lib/wine/olesvr.dll.so
lib/wine/olesvr32.dll.so
lib/wine/opengl32.dll.so
+lib/wine/osversioncheck.exe.so
+lib/wine/progman.exe.so
lib/wine/psapi.dll.so
lib/wine/qcap.dll.so
lib/wine/quartz.dll.so
lib/wine/rasapi16.dll.so
lib/wine/rasapi32.dll.so
+lib/wine/regapi.exe.so
+lib/wine/regedit.exe.so
+lib/wine/regsvr32.exe.so
+lib/wine/regtest.exe.so
lib/wine/riched32.dll.so
lib/wine/rpcrt4.dll.so
lib/wine/serialui.dll.so
@@ -321,6 +339,7 @@
lib/wine/shell32.dll.so
lib/wine/shfolder.dll.so
lib/wine/shlwapi.dll.so
+lib/wine/snmpapi.dll.so
lib/wine/sound.dll.so
lib/wine/sti.dll.so
lib/wine/storage.dll.so
@@ -331,24 +350,36 @@
lib/wine/ttydrv.dll.so
lib/wine/twain_32.dll.so
lib/wine/typelib.dll.so
+lib/wine/uninstaller.exe.so
lib/wine/url.dll.so
lib/wine/urlmon.dll.so
lib/wine/user.exe.so
lib/wine/user32.dll.so
lib/wine/ver.dll.so
lib/wine/version.dll.so
+lib/wine/view.exe.so
lib/wine/w32skrnl.dll.so
lib/wine/w32sys.dll.so
+lib/wine/wcmd.exe.so
lib/wine/win32s16.dll.so
lib/wine/win87em.dll.so
lib/wine/winaspi.dll.so
lib/wine/windebug.dll.so
+lib/wine/winealsa.drv.so
lib/wine/winearts.drv.so
+lib/wine/wineconsole.exe.so
+lib/wine/winedbg.exe.so
lib/wine/winedos.dll.so
+lib/wine/winefile.exe.so
+lib/wine/winemine.exe.so
+lib/wine/winemp3.acm.so
lib/wine/wineoss.drv.so
+lib/wine/winepath.exe.so
lib/wine/wineps.dll.so
lib/wine/wineps16.dll.so
+lib/wine/winetest.exe.so
lib/wine/wing.dll.so
+lib/wine/winhelp.exe.so
lib/wine/wininet.dll.so
lib/wine/winmm.dll.so
lib/wine/winnls.dll.so
@@ -356,6 +387,7 @@
lib/wine/winsock.dll.so
lib/wine/winspool.drv.so
lib/wine/wintrust.dll.so
+lib/wine/winver.exe.so
lib/wine/wnaspi32.dll.so
lib/wine/wow32.dll.so
lib/wine/wprocs.dll.so
Index: distinfo
===================================================================
RCS file: /cvsroot/pkgsrc/emulators/wine/distinfo,v
retrieving revision 1.7
diff -u -r1.7 distinfo
--- distinfo 2002/04/20 08:20:16 1.7
+++ distinfo 2002/07/20 12:24:16
@@ -1,5 +1,6 @@
$NetBSD: distinfo,v 1.7 2002/04/20 08:20:16 rh Exp $
-SHA1 (Wine-20020411.tar.gz) = d83060fc97f02bf9deaef0a23951042d631f268c
-Size (Wine-20020411.tar.gz) = 7270988 bytes
+SHA1 (Wine-20020710.tar.gz) = 69e0bc8e52e01e209cf30508b49add62d24bc82a
+Size (Wine-20020710.tar.gz) = 7371859 bytes
SHA1 (patch-aa) = bf45f5b343bda55a0809459469a2476b566ad7d5
+SHA1 (patch-ab) = 8f24e498cf382f70213d722e2ecf64e694c6b730
NEW FILE: patches/patch-ab
$NetBSD$
--- memory/global.c.orig Wed Jul 3 21:10:44 2002
+++ memory/global.c
@@ -22,6 +22,7 @@
#include "config.h"
#include "wine/port.h"
+#include <sys/param.h>
#include <sys/types.h>
#include <stdlib.h>
#include <time.h>
>How-To-Repeat:
>Fix:
>Release-Note:
>Audit-Trail:
>Unformatted: